Massive Disruption Hits Millions of ChatGPT Users Globally
In a major disruption affecting users around the globe, OpenAI’s flagship artificial intelligence platform, ChatGPT, suffered a widespread outage. Millions of users across multiple continents reported severe accessibility issues, ranging from complete inability to access the website and mobile apps to stalled conversations and total failure of AI image generation capabilities. The service interruption started abruptly during peak working hours, creating significant hurdles for professionals, developers, students, and businesses who rely heavily on the generative AI tool for daily tasks.
Core Features Affected: DALL-E Image Generation and Search Paralyzed
According to user reports across tracking platforms like Downdetector, the outage was not limited to basic text queries. The disruption hit advanced AI features particularly hard. Users attempting to generate artwork, conceptual designs, or visual assets through ChatGPT’s integrated DALL-E image generation tool were met with persistent error messages such as “Failed to generate image” or “An error occurred during processing.” Additionally, real-time web browsing capabilities, file uploads, and custom GPT instances faced severe latency, bringing complex automated workflows to a complete standstill worldwide.
OpenAI Acknowledges Outage and Begins Investigation
As complaints flooded social media platforms, OpenAI formally acknowledged the widespread service disruption on its official status page. The company confirmed that it was actively investigating an issue causing elevated error rates and degraded performance across ChatGPT and its associated API endpoints. Engineers at the San Francisco-based AI giant stated that they identified the underlying anomaly within their infrastructure and were deploying immediate mitigation measures to stabilize server traffic and restore normal system operations.
Impact on Global Businesses and Developer Ecosystem
The sudden downtime once again underscored the global tech sector’s growing dependence on centralized AI infrastructure. Thousands of third-party applications, enterprise software tools, and customer service bots built on top of OpenAI’s API experienced unexpected downtime or degraded functionality. Industry analysts noted that while cloud-based AI platforms offer unmatched efficiency, global outages of this magnitude highlight the operational risks for businesses operating without secondary backup systems or alternative open-source AI models.
Service Restoration and Precautionary Steps for Users
Following a series of emergency server patches and traffic rerouting by OpenAI’s technical team, ChatGPT services gradually began returning to normal functionality for users globally. OpenAI advised users who continue to experience minor glitches or slow response times to clear their web browser cache, log out and re-login to their accounts, or wait momentarily while background API queues clear out completely.
